net: phy: mediatek: Re-organize MediaTek ethernet phy drivers

Re-organize MediaTek ethernet phy driver files and get ready to integrate
some common functions and add new 2.5G phy driver.
mtk-ge.c: MT7530 Gphy on MT7621 & MT7531 Gphy
mtk-ge-soc.c: Built-in Gphy on MT7981 & Built-in switch Gphy on MT7988
mtk-2p5ge.c: Planned for built-in 2.5G phy on MT7988

@ -0,0 +1,22 @@
# S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-only
config MEDIATEK_GE_PHY
tristate "MediaTek Gigabit Ethernet PHYs"
help
Supports the MediaTek non-built-in Gigabit Ethernet PHYs.
Non-built-in Gigabit Ethernet PHYs include mt7530/mt7531.
You may find mt7530 inside mt7621. This driver shares some
common operations with MediaTek SoC built-in Gigabit
Ethernet PHYs.
config MEDIATEK_GE_SOC_PHY
tristate "MediaTek SoC Ethernet PHYs"
depends on (ARM64 && ARCH_MEDIATEK) || COMPILE_TEST
depends on NVMEM_MTK_EFUSE
help
Supports MediaTek SoC built-in Gigabit Ethernet PHYs.
Include support for built-in Ethernet PHYs which are present in
the MT7981 and MT7988 SoCs. These PHYs need calibration data
present in the SoCs efuse and will dynamically calibrate VCM
(common-mode voltage) during startup.
